C# initialize an object

WebAs you said, you would either have to use reflection, or create a "Clone" method that would generate a new child object using a parent object as input, like so: public class MyObjectSearch : MyObject { // Other code public static MyObjectSearch CloneFromMyObject (MyObject obj) { var newObj = new MyObjectSearch (); // Copy … WebAug 21, 2024 · This is how the C# specification defines the C# instance constructor: An instance constructor is a member that implements the actions required to initialize an instance of a class. You use instance …

c# - How to declare an array of an object statically - Stack Overflow

WebC# - Object Initializer Syntax. C# 3.0 (.NET 3.5) introduced Object Initializer Syntax, a new way to initialize an object of a class or collection.Object initializers allow you to … WebJan 13, 2013 · Console.WriteLine (Globals.Name); Globals.onlineMemeber.Add ("Hogan"); Static objects are only "created" once. Thus everywhere your application uses the object will be from the same location. They are by definition global. To use this object in multiple places simply reference the object name and the element you want to access. images of handmade baseball cards https://autogold44.com

Object and Collection Initializers - C# Programming Guide

WebMay 23, 2011 · You need to fill the array with object instances. new MyObject [] { new MyObject (a, b, c), new MyObject (d, e, f) } You'll have to initialize the array with new object instances. class MyObject { int i1; string s1; double d1; public MyObject (int i, string s, double d) { i1 = i; s1 = s; d1 = d; } }; static MyObject [] myO = new MyObject ... WebClasses and Objects. You learned from the previous chapter that C# is an object-oriented programming language. Everything in C# is associated with classes and objects, along … WebJan 31, 2024 · init accessors. An init only property (or indexer) is declared by using the init accessor in place of the set accessor: C#. class Student { public string FirstName { get; init; } public string LastName { get; init; } } An instance property containing an init accessor is considered settable in the following circumstances, except when in a local ... list of all books written by debbie macomber

Object Initializer Syntax in C# - TutorialsTeacher

Category:Is there a pattern for initializing objects created via a DI container

Tags:C# initialize an object

C# initialize an object

C# object initialization syntax in F# - iditect.com

WebAug 18, 2024 · A typical C# program creates many objects, which as you know, interact by invoking methods. We can Create objects in C# in the following ways: 1) Using the ‘new’ … WebApr 11, 2024 · See also. A static constructor is used to initialize any static data, or to perform a particular action that needs to be performed only once. It is called automatically before the first instance is created or any static members are referenced. A static constructor will be called at most once. C#. class SimpleClass { // Static variable that …

C# initialize an object

Did you know?

WebSep 29, 2024 · Collection initializers let you specify one or more element initializers when you initialize a collection type that implements IEnumerable and has Add with the … WebFeb 28, 2014 · Add a comment. 1. There are 3 main benefits of object Initialization. Avoid lot of keystrokes,The efficiency of software programs is sometimes measured by the number of keystrokes it requires to write a specific function.

Web2 Answers. Declaring - Declaring a variable means to introduce a new variable to the program. You define its type and its name. Instantiate - Instantiating a class means to create a new instance of the class. Source. MyObject x = new MyObject (); //we are making a new instance of the class MyObject. Initialize - To initialize a variable means ... WebNov 16, 2024 · C# Tip: Access items from the end of the array using the ^ operator; Health Checks in .NET: 2 ways to check communication with MongoDB; C# Tip: Initialize lists size to improve performance; Davide's Code and Architecture Notes - Understanding Elasticity and Scalability with Pokémon Go and TikTok

WebMay 10, 2024 · C# Tip: Access items from the end of the array using the ^ operator; Health Checks in .NET: 2 ways to check communication with MongoDB; C# Tip: Initialize lists size to improve performance; Davide's … WebIn F#, object initialization can be done using an object expression or using record expressions. Here's an example of how to initialize an object in F#: ... The syntax for initializing a record in F# is similar to initializing an object using an object initializer in C#. More C# Questions. Adding new strings to resource.resx not reflecting into ...

WebThe syntax to create JSON using Newtonsoft package is as follows: ClassName objectName = new ClassName(); string jsonStr = JsonConvert.SerializeObject( objectName); Explanation: In the above …

WebObject Initializer in C#. In C#, there is also another way to initialize an object apart from constructors and that is using an object initializer.. An object initializer is simply a syntax or a way of quickly initializing an … images of hand lenslist of all books written by karen kingsburyWebFeb 11, 2024 · Use the Constructor Parameters to Initialize an Array of Objects in C#; Create get and set Methods to Complete the Constructor Call Activities the Whole … list of all books written by jrr tolkienWeb2 days ago · For example, you could use the parameters to initialize properties or in the code of methods and property accessors. Primary constructors were introduced for records in C# 9 as part of the positional syntax for records. C# 12 extends them to all classes and structs. The basic syntax and usage for a primary constructor is: list of all books written by mark twainWebMay 26, 2024 · Creating a new object of the BankAccount type means defining a constructor that assigns those values. A constructor is a member that has the same name as the class. It's used to initialize objects of that class type. Add the following constructor to the BankAccount type. Place the following code above the declaration of MakeDeposit: images of handmade sympathy cardsWebYou need to initialize each member of the array separatedly. houses[0] = new GameObject(..); Only then can you access the object without compilation errors. So you … images of handmade drawer pullsWebIf you use a built-in C# type (e.g. String) and you want to initialize the constant member with a compile time value, you still get an error: e.g. public const string MyNumber = SetMyString(); private string SetMyString() { return "test"; } Solving the problem you can declare a member with: static readonly list of all books written by ernest hemingway